首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>如何在powershell中设置$env:PATH

如何在powershell中设置$env:PATH
EN

Stack Overflow用户
提问于 2019-10-04 06:48:12
回答 2查看 624关注 0票数 2

如果正确设置了将完整路径指定为below.the路径。Rabbitmq-服务启动成功。

代码语言:javascript
运行
复制
$env:Path += ";C:\\Program Files\\erl9.2\\erts-9.2\\bin;
                C:\\Program Files\\RabbitMQ Server\\rabbitmq_server-3.6.11\\sbin;C:\\Program Files\\erl9.2\\bin"

 "Added Erlang and RabbitMQ to Path"

  # Install RabbitMQ Service and Enable Management Console
  rabbitmq-service stop     
  rabbitmq-service remove
  rabbitmq-plugins enable rabbitmq_management --offline
  rabbitmq-service install
  rabbitmq-service start

但是,如果我将路径设置为如下所示,则会设置路径,但在启动rabbitmq-service时会遇到问题。它抛出了一个错误'ERLANG_HOME not error‘。我是不是遗漏了什么?

代码语言:javascript
运行
复制
$ERLANG_HOME = "$env:PROGRAMFILES\erl9.2"
$ERTS_HOME = "$env:PROGRAMFILES\erts-9.2"
$RABBITMQ_HOME = "$env:PROGRAMFILES\RabbitMQ Server\rabbitmq_server-3.6.11"

$env:Path += ";$ERTS_HOME\\bin;$RABBITMQ_HOME\\sbin;$ERLANG_HOME\\bin"

"Added Erlang and RabbitMQ to Path"

# Install RabbitMQ Service and Enable Management Console
rabbitmq-service stop   
rabbitmq-service remove
rabbitmq-plugins enable rabbitmq_management --offline
rabbitmq-service install
rabbitmq-service start
E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2019-10-04 11:09:25

使用$env:ERLANG_HOME而不是$ERLANG_HOME来正确设置路径。

代码语言:javascript
运行
复制
$env:ERLANG_HOME = "$env:PROGRAMFILES\erl9.2"
$env:ERTS_HOME = "$env:PROGRAMFILES\erl9.2\erts-9.2"
$env:RABBITMQ_HOME = "$env:PROGRAMFILES\RabbitMQ Server\rabbitmq_server-3.6.11"

$env:PATH += ";$env:ERLANG_HOME\bin;$env:ERTS_HOME\bin;$env:RABBITMQ_HOME\sbin"
票数 2
EN

Stack Overflow用户

发布于 2020-01-24 22:19:25

代码语言:javascript
运行
复制
$env:ERLANG_HOME = "$env:ProgramFiles\erl9.0"
$env:ERTS_HOME = "$env:ProgramFiles\erl9.0\erts-9.0"
$env:RABBITMQ_HOME = "$env:ProgramFiles\RabbitMQ Server\rabbitmq_server-3.6.12"
$env:PATH += ";$env:ERLANG_HOME\bin;$env:ERTS_HOME\bin;$env:RABBITMQ_HOME\sbin"
rabbitmq-service stop 
rabbitmq-service remove
rabbitmq-plugins enable rabbitmq_management --offline
rabbitmq-service install
rabbitmq-service start

在PowerShell v5.1中,上面的方法对我有效吗?谢谢你们两位

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/58227812

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档